direct speech
US /ˌdɪ.rekt ˈspiːtʃ/
UK /ˌdɪ.rekt ˈspiːtʃ/

1.
directe rede, directe spraak
the actual words that someone says, written or reported exactly as they were spoken, usually enclosed in quotation marks
:
•
In the sentence, 'He said, "I am tired,"' the part "I am tired" is direct speech.
In de zin 'Hij zei: "Ik ben moe"' is het deel "Ik ben moe" directe rede.
•
Always use quotation marks for direct speech.
